Master the Art of Cooking Chicken Wings in a Pressure Cooker
Chicken wings are a crowd-pleasing favorite, whether you’re hosting a game night or simply craving a delicious snack. While traditional methods of cooking wings can take quite some time, using a pressure cooker can significantly cut down on the cooking time without compromising on flavor or tenderness. In this article, we will guide you through the steps to cook chicken wings perfectly in a pressure cooker.
Ingredients:
- 2 pounds of chicken wings
- 1 cup of your favorite wing sauce
- 1 cup of chicken broth
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Optional: additional seasonings like garlic powder, paprika, or cayenne pepper to add some extra kick
Instructions:
- Start by cleaning and patting dry the chicken wings. This helps ensure a crispier end result.
- Season the wings with salt, pepper, and any other desired seasonings. Don’t be afraid to get creative and experiment with different flavors.
- Preheat your pressure cooker by turning it on and selecting the appropriate setting for poultry. This may vary depending on the brand and model of your pressure cooker.
- Add the chicken broth to the pressure cooker. The broth will infuse the wings with moisture and flavor.
- Place the seasoned wings into the pressure cooker pot. Make sure they are arranged in a single layer to ensure even cooking.
- Secure the lid of the pressure cooker and set the cooking time according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Generally, cooking chicken wings in a pressure cooker takes around 10-15 minutes.
- Once the cooking time is complete, carefully release the pressure according to your pressure cooker’s manual. This step is crucial to avoid any accidents and ensure safety.
- Open the lid and brush the wings with your favorite wing sauce. Whether you prefer tangy BBQ, spicy buffalo, or a sweet and sticky glaze, the choice is yours!
- If you desire a crispy finish, you can place the sauced wings under the broiler for a few minutes. Keep a close eye on them to prevent burning.
- Transfer the cooked and sauced wings to a serving platter, and garnish with chopped fresh herbs or sesame seeds for an extra touch of flavor and visual appeal.
- Serve your delicious pressure cooker chicken wings hot and enjoy with your favorite dipping sauces, celery sticks, and carrot sticks.
